Manchester City boss Roberto Mancini says it is "ridiculous" that injured striker Sergio Aguero has been called up for international duty.
City expects the striker to be out until mid-September after suffering a knee injury in last week's opening Barclays Premier League win over Southampton.
But that has not stopped Argentina coach Alejandro Sabella from naming the 24-year-old to his squad for World Cup qualifiers against Paraguay and Peru on Sept. 7 and 11, respectively.
City had earmarked the Sept. 15 trip to Stoke as the earliest possible date for a comeback.
